As the 2027 political contest for Oyo South Senatorial District gathers momentum, the battle is increasingly shifting from political calculations to a more consequential question: who has the experience and legislative capacity to effectively represent the district at the National Assembly?

 

Among the candidates in the race for the Oyo South seat in the Senate, Hon. Adedeji Dhikrullahi Stanley Olajide Odidiomo is presenting himself as a candidate whose case should be judged not merely by promises, but by his record in public office.

 

The two term member representing Ibadan North-West/Ibadan South-West federal constituency of Oyo state is the senatorial candidate of the Allied Peoples’ Movement, APM, for Oyo South. His emergence followed the party’s primary and affirmation process involving the nine local government areas that make up the senatorial district.

 

But what makes Olajide’s candidacy particularly interesting is the argument that he is not approaching the Senate as a political novice.

 

He is coming with legislative experience.

 

In an institution where understanding legislative procedure, committee work, policy formulation and government processes is critical, experience can be a major advantage.

Olajide has served two terms in the House of Representatives and currently chairs the House Committee on Digital, Information Communication Technology and Cybersecurity.

 

That experience gives him familiarity with the workings of the National Assembly and the processes through which legislation, oversight and constituency projects are pursued.

 

For Oyo South voters, the question is therefore not simply whether a candidate can speak eloquently about development, but whether that candidate understands how to convert legislative influence into tangible benefits for the people.

 

This is where Olajide’s supporters believe his experience gives him an edge.

 

One of the strongest arguments being advanced for Olajide’s candidacy is his constituency record.

 

His supporters also point to constituency interventions credited to him, particularly in education and digital development.

 

Another factor that distinguishes the current campaign is Olajide’s attempt to engage directly with communities. He has also embarked on grassroots consultations involving party leaders, ward executives, youth leaders, women groups and other stakeholders. This approach is significant because political representation is ultimately about people.

 

A senator does not represent statistics. A senator represents communities, families, workers, students, traders, farmers, professionals, young people and the elderly. The closer a representative remains to these groups, the easier it becomes to understand their concerns and take those concerns to the legislative chamber.

 

Olajide’s proposed agenda for Oyo South also extends beyond individual constituency projects. His public statements have emphasised digital inclusion, education, entrepreneurship, infrastructure, youth empowerment, economic opportunity and improved access to government programmes. He has identified additional ICT hubs, healthcare interventions and road projects as areas requiring further attention.

The 2027 election will inevitably produce competing narratives. Other candidates will have their own experience, political structures, supporters and programmes. Voters will have the responsibility of examining each candidate’s record and determining who deserves their mandate.

 

But elections should not be reduced to who has the loudest campaign or the biggest political gathering. They should be about capacity, character, competence, accessibility and measurable results.

 

On those criteria, Olajide has a record that gives his candidacy a serious foundation. He has served two terms in the House of Representatives. He currently occupies a strategic committee leadership position focused on digital technology and cybersecurity. He has facilitated educational and digital learning projects, engaged with constituents and stakeholders, and continued to articulate an agenda centred on youth development, infrastructure and economic opportunity.

 

The case for Olajide, therefore, is not simply that he wants to become a senator. It is that he has already been in the arena of public service and is asking voters to judge what he has done before deciding what he may do next.

 

For Oyo South, the 2027 election presents an opportunity for voters to weigh competing promises against parliamentary experience, accessibility and demonstrable records of public service.

 

And for supporters of Adedeji Dhikrullahi Stanley Olajide, the argument is increasingly clear: If effective representation requires legislative exposure, accessibility, legislative knowledge, youth development and a demonstrable commitment to constituency needs, then Odidiomo has a compelling case for the Oyo South Senate seat.

 

The final verdict, however, belongs to the voters.
